hi when working with your alpha in PM

turn the ref slider in the alpha menu to somewhere between 8-15 this will soften the edges, you can also turn the max button on, then you will have to play a bit with intensity settings and focal shift a bit til ya get the bumps without the edges.

In one of the newbie challenges in the challenges forum has scripts that show how to alter the alphas a bit to get em to work without the lines…take a look at those scripts if ya got the time.

When drawing polyframe (drtawing quads in diferent colors) the mesh has several colors (but it’s just one object), however when I export to obj it exports each color of the mesh separately, it exports an obj file with 4 objects… anyone knows why?

That’s just material groups. If you only want one, make sure all of your model is visible, then click Tool > Polygroups > Group Visible and you’ll reduce everything to one group.
